Enhanced P-cycling with stylosanthes (Stylosanthes guianensis) in upland rice-based cropping systems in Madagascar
Accumulated the evidence from pot and field trials that Stylosanthes guianensis has high solubilization capacity of Fe-bound P in soils, superior P uptakes than maize, rice, and soybean, and increases the subsequent rice yield relative to those grown after other crops under typical P-deficient uplan...
